TEMPO.CO, Karanganyar - The spokesperson of the Prabowo-Sandiaga campaign team, Ferry Juliantono, claimed the pair's electability rate in Central Java was showing an upward trend following multiple activities and campaigns in the province.

In the past week, the electability rate of incumbent president Joko Widodo or Jokowi reportedly dropped 2 percent in the region. “I think the decline is not that small,” said Ferry in Karanganyar, Friday, February 8.

Ferry believed Jokowi’s electability rate had slipped by 4 percent, “in balance with the increased electability rate of Prabowo.” Meanwhile, undecided voters remained at 17-20 percent.

Ferry said Prabowo's rising electability rate in Central Java was attibutable to his camp's penetration into the province in the past few months. “Central Java has become the main focus of the Prabowo-Sandiaga ticket's activities,” Ferry said.

According to him, the electability rate of the Prabowo-Sandiaga pair would continue to increase ahead of the presidential election. “I believe the figure will cross the incumbent’s [electability rate],” he said.
